Administrator: Cost of hiring?

  • Common salary in Birmingham: £25,420 yearly
  • Typical salaries range from £25,420£40,961 yearly

*Indeed data (GB)

What's the average time to fill an administrator role?

The average time to fill an administrator role is 45 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
